Columbia/Okura LLC recently marked the milestone of shipping its 1,000th robotic palletizer. 

The company has designed and commissioned many successful palletizing systems, handling a wide range of products across dozens of industries worldwide. From bag palletizing systems in abusive and harsh environments to high-speed, multi-robot, multi-picking case applications, Columbia/Okura has handled almost any type of product packaging in virtually any application.

Over the past 26 years, the team has gathered for every 100 robots sold milestone, celebrating with lunch and a team photo with the robot. However, due to COVID-19, in-person celebrations have been canceled for the last milestones (900th system sold), making this in-person celebration of 1,000 robots even better.

The 1,000th system will be sent to Cherry Farms Seed Co. in NC, with a crest on the arm to denote the 1,000th robot. The system includes the Ai1800 robot, sheet presenter, pallet dispenser, bag end-effector, bag infeed, station conveyor, and a gravity pickup conveyor.
